what are hydroboost brakes?
I see that the 99+ cobras (maybe older) run a hydroboost brake system. Looks like some kind of device replaces the brake booster and it runs a few more lines into the master cylinder. Is this a better system (works better?) and can ours be replaced with it? If so, what do we need, hydroboost & master cylinder? Or more than that? thanks.
Yes hydroboost brake systems are better. They produce substantial gain in overall braking power and react a lot quicker when you step on the pedal and they are not affected by large duration camshafts or forced induction systems.
